MongoDB: 实现数据仓库功能的利器(mongodb做数据仓库)
MongoDB是一个流行的NoSQL(非关系型)数据库,它有助于实现基于多种架构的数据仓库功能。它是一个开源的文档数据库,支持数据互操作性,可提供可靠的数据管理功能。
MongoDB的优势在于,它可以让用户把数据存储在“文档”中,从而更容易跟踪、分析和组织每一个单独的文档。它还可以支持复杂查询,例如多种搜索类型和搜索结果的过滤,以及根据联合查询的聚合函数的计算,从而提高查询的效率和精度。另外,它还可以支持事务处理,可以在一次事务中处理多个操作,确保正确性和完整性。
MongoDB的另一个优势是它的容量。MongoDB的大容量可以存储大量数据,并让管理者充分控制存储,而不需要严格的设计。这种容量特性使 MongoDB成为一个强大的数据仓库解决方案,即使在大数据量的情况下也能有效地提供数据搜索和计算。
MongoDB还是一个弹性的数据库,它可以在云环境中相互共享数据和应用,并允许多个服务器实例一起工作。因此,与其他数据库系统相比,MongoDB可以在各种环境下更灵活地管理数据。
总的来说,MongoDB的多种功能为数据仓库提供了可靠和高效的数据存储功能。它能实现弹性,提供大容量,可以支持复杂查询以及事务处理,从而成为企业中非常流行的数据存储工具之一。